What Is Chlorella and What Does It Do for Detoxification?
Chlorella is a single-celled freshwater green algae — primarily Chlorella vulgaris and Chlorella pyrenoidosa — that functions as both a nutrient-dense superfood and a natural heavy metal binder. Its unique cell wall structure attracts and traps toxins in the gastrointestinal tract, preventing their absorption and facilitating excretion through stool.
Measuring just 2–10 microns in diameter, chlorella is microscopic yet extraordinarily nutrient-dense. It contains roughly 50–60% protein with a complete amino acid profile, plus significant amounts of B vitamins (B1, B2, B6, B12, folate), iron, magnesium, beta-carotene, and nucleic acids (RNA/DNA). Most commercially available chlorella is cultivated in controlled freshwater ponds in Japan and Taiwan, then harvested, dried, and processed into powder or tablet form [1].
What makes chlorella particularly relevant for detoxification is its chlorophyll content — at 3–5% by dry weight, it's the most chlorophyll-dense organism known. Chlorophyll supports liver phase II detoxification pathways, binds certain toxins in the gut, and acts as a potent antioxidant WholisticMatters, Chlorella vulgaris.
What nutrients does chlorella contain?
Chlorella's nutrient profile is remarkably dense for a single-celled organism. Per 100g of dried chlorella, you'll typically find approximately 50–60g protein, 58mg iron (higher than beef), 315mg magnesium, 3–5g chlorophyll, plus significant B vitamins and beta-carotene. The protein is complete, meaning it contains all nine essential amino acids needed for human nutrition.
How Does Chlorella Work as a Detoxifier in the Body?
Chlorella detoxifies through three primary mechanisms: heavy metal chelation via cell wall polysaccharides, chlorophyll-mediated antioxidant activity, and immune system modulation. Its negatively charged cell wall attracts positively charged heavy metal ions, binding them in the gut and preventing reabsorption into the bloodstream.
How does chlorella bind heavy metals?
The key mechanism is electrostatic attraction. Chlorella's cell wall contains polysaccharides and a compound called sporopollenin, both of which carry a strong negative charge. Heavy metals like mercury (Hg²⁺), lead (Pb²⁺), cadmium (Cd²⁺), and arsenic exist as positively charged ions. When chlorella encounters these metals in the gastrointestinal tract, the cell wall binds them through ion exchange, preventing intestinal absorption and promoting fecal excretion. Animal studies demonstrate that dietary chlorella supplementation can reduce cadmium accumulation in tissues and facilitate excretion [2]. A study on patients with dental amalgams found that long-term algae supplementation (including chlorella) reduced mercury and tin levels while modulating antioxidant enzyme activity [3].
How does chlorophyll support detoxification?
Chlorella's chlorophyll content (3–5%) — the highest of any plant — provides antioxidant, anti-inflammatory, and direct detoxification support. Chlorophyll neutralizes free radicals, reduces inflammation markers including CRP and IL-6, supports liver phase II detoxification through glutathione conjugation, and can bind certain environmental toxins (aflatoxins, dioxins, pesticides) in the gut, preventing their absorption.
Does chlorella support immune function?
Research suggests chlorella supplementation increases natural killer (NK) cell activity and enhances salivary IgA antibody production, strengthening mucosal immunity in the respiratory and GI tracts. Studies in healthy adults have shown measurable increases in NK cell activity and interferon-gamma levels after chlorella supplementation [1]. This immune-modulating effect is generally beneficial but is why those with autoimmune conditions should exercise caution.
Can chlorella improve cardiovascular health?
A meta-analysis of randomized controlled trials found that chlorella supplementation improved total cholesterol, LDL cholesterol, systolic blood pressure, diastolic blood pressure, and fasting blood glucose levels. Specifically, supplementation for 8 weeks or longer at doses above 4g/day produced significant reductions in total and LDL cholesterol, as well as blood pressure in hypertensive individuals [6]. A controlled study found participants taking 5g chlorella daily showed a 10% reduction in triglycerides and an 11% reduction in LDL cholesterol Healthline [17].
How Well Is Chlorella Absorbed — and Why Does Cell Wall Processing Matter?
Broken cell wall chlorella achieves roughly 80% bioavailability compared to only 40% for intact cell wall forms, making cell wall processing the single most important factor in chlorella supplement quality. Without breaking the tough cellulose cell wall, most nutrients remain trapped and pass through your body undigested.
Humans lack cellulase, the enzyme needed to break down cellulose. Chlorella's cell wall is made primarily of cellulose, making intact cells largely indigestible. Research confirms that more than 80% of chlorella proteins become digestible after mechanical cell wall disruption [1]. Cell wall disruption methods include mechanical milling, high-pressure processing, and enzymatic treatment [5].
When shopping for chlorella, look for labels that explicitly state "broken cell wall" or "cracked cell wall." Products without this designation likely contain intact cells with significantly reduced bioavailability — both for nutrient absorption and for heavy metal binding capacity.
How Much Chlorella Should You Take for Detox Support?
For general health maintenance, take 3–6g of broken cell wall chlorella daily in divided doses with meals. For targeted heavy metal detox protocols, doses of 6–10g daily may be used, though always start at 1–2g and increase gradually over 2–4 weeks to assess tolerance and minimize GI side effects.
Most clinical studies have used doses of 3–10g daily for periods of 2–3 months WebMD [15]. Doses up to 10–15g per day appear safe based on available evidence Examine.com [16]. Cardiovascular benefits have been observed with as little as 4g per day.
Dosing by form:
- Powder: 1–2 teaspoons daily (1 tsp ≈ 3g) — add to smoothies, water, or juice
- Tablets: 6–12 tablets daily (typically 500mg each) — convenient, no taste
- Capsules: 6–12 capsules daily (typically 500mg each) — no taste, easy to swallow
Timing tips: Take with meals to improve absorption of fat-soluble nutrients and reduce nausea. Divide into 2–3 doses throughout the day rather than taking one large dose. If using for heavy metal support, consistency over months matters more than taking high single doses.

Is Chlorella Safe? What Are the Side Effects and Drug Interactions?
Chlorella is generally well-tolerated at recommended doses, with most side effects being mild and temporary — GI discomfort (nausea, diarrhea, cramping) in the first 1–2 weeks, green stools from chlorophyll (completely harmless), and occasional mild headache or fatigue as the body adjusts.
A clinical trial in hepatitis C patients reported that the main side effects of chlorella supplementation were mild constipation and diarrhea, both of which resolved within the first two weeks. No patients reported abdominal pain, fever, or other serious complaints during the 12-week study [7].
Contraindications:
- Autoimmune diseases: Chlorella stimulates immune activity (NK cells, cytokines), which may worsen symptoms of lupus, MS, or rheumatoid arthritis
- Warfarin/blood thinners: Chlorella contains vitamin K, which can interfere with anticoagulation — monitor INR closely
- Iodine sensitivity: Chlorella contains iodine and may affect thyroid function
- Pregnancy/breastfeeding: Insufficient safety data — consult your doctor
Drug interactions: Chlorella may reduce the effectiveness of immunosuppressant medications. It may interfere with warfarin (vitamin K content) and thyroid medications (iodine content). Always maintain 2+ hours between chlorella and any prescription medication, and consult your healthcare provider before starting.
Quality safety note: Choose products that are third-party tested for heavy metals and microcystin contamination. Algae supplements from uncontrolled sources may paradoxically contain the very contaminants you're trying to avoid [8].
What Can Chlorella Actually Do for You — and What Are Its Limits?
Chlorella offers real, evidence-backed benefits for cardiovascular health, nutrient supplementation, and immune support, with promising but less conclusive evidence for heavy metal detoxification. Expect gradual improvements over 8–12 weeks of consistent supplementation — not overnight miracles.
What the evidence strongly supports:
- Improvements in cholesterol, blood pressure, and blood sugar markers (meta-analysis-level evidence)
- Nutrient supplementation — protein, iron, B vitamins, chlorophyll, antioxidants
- Immune modulation — increased NK cell activity, IgA production
What the evidence moderately supports:
- Heavy metal binding in the GI tract (strong in animal studies, limited human data)
- Anti-inflammatory and antioxidant effects from chlorophyll
- Gut health support through prebiotic fiber content
What to be realistic about:
- Most heavy metal detox evidence comes from animal studies — human clinical trials are limited
- Chlorella supports your body's existing detox pathways but doesn't replace liver and kidney function
- For confirmed heavy metal toxicity, medical chelation therapy (EDTA, DMSA) under physician supervision is the standard of care
- Individual results vary based on health status, exposure levels, and supplement quality
The timeline for noticeable benefits is typically 4–8 weeks for cardiovascular markers and 2–4 weeks for digestive comfort. Heavy metal reduction, if measurable, requires consistent supplementation over 3–6 months.
